Diaz Tosses One-Hitter as Mustangs Softball Shuts out D3 No. 7 Brookdale; Game 2 Canceled Due to Rain

LINCROFT, N.J., April 17, 2024 – Gabriella Diaz was brilliant while the bats were hot for the Monroe College Mustangs softball team on Tuesday, helping the Mustangs defeat NJCAA Div. III No. 7 Brookdale Community College, 12-0, in five innings. Game 2 was then canceled due to inclement weather. The Mustangs improve to 16-23 overall with the win, while the Jersey Blues fall to 10-9.
 
GAME 1: Monroe 12, D3 #7 Brookdale 0 (5 INN)
The Mustangs got off to a quick start in Wednesday's opener. Gabrielle Gonzalez led off the game with a double to left. After she stole third, a sacrifice fly to center by Angie Ordonez brought her home to make it a 1-0 game. Marissa Thalassinos followed with a double, and then Amber Miltenberg walked. Aisling Wilson hit Monroe's third double of the inning to clear the bases and leave the visitors up, 3-0.
 
After a scoreless second, the Mustangs exploded in the third. Thalassinos, Miltenberg and Wilson hit three straight singles to load the bases with nobody out. Veronika Anderson then brought them all home on a double to right to make it a 6-0 score. After a walk by Nathalie Mongrain, Gabriella Diaz helped herself out with an RBI double that brought Anderson home for a 7-0 edge. With two down, Ordonez hit a two-RBI double to left, pushing Monroe's lead to 9-0.
 
The odd innings were gold for the Mustangs in Game 1, as they rallied again in the fifth. Mongrain opened the inning with a single, and then Diaz drew a walk. Gonzalez then beat out a bunt to load the bases. A fielder's choice caught Mongrain at home for the first out, and then the runner at third jumped early for the second out of the frame. Thalassinos then ripped a triple to center, plating two runs to extend the lead to 11-0. Miltenberg then quickly brought her home on a single to left, bringing the score to 12-0 to force the run-rule finish after five frames.
 
Diaz had her best outing of the season in the circle in Game 1. She tossed all five frames, allowing just one hit and no runs with five strikeouts to pick up her seventh victory of the season. Mallory Shevlin took the loss for Brookdale after yielding 12 runs in five innings.
 
Thalassinos finished 3-for-4 with three runs, two RBIs, a triple and a double in Game 1. Gonzalez also went 3-for-4 with two runs, a double and three stolen bases. Miltenberg batted 2-for-3 with two runs and an RBI. Anderson knocked in three runs and scored once after going 2-for-3 with a double. Wilson doubled as well in a 2-for-3 outing, knocking in two runs while scoring once herself. Ordonez plated three runs and scored another in a 1-for-3 game. Diaz gave herself a boost with an RBI and a run in a 1-for-2 effort. Mongrain scored once after hitting 1-for-2.
 
*Game 2 was canceled due to inclement weather*
 
The Mustangs get a day off to travel tomorrow before beginning a two-day, four-game series at WVU Potomac State College this Friday, April 19, in Keyser, W.V. Friday's doubleheader is set to begin at 2 p.m.
 
ABOUT THE ATHLETIC PROGRAM AT MONROE COLLEGE
The athletic program at Monroe College encompasses a total of 28 teams competing across nine sports. There are 20 varsity and junior varsity programs, as well the Monroe College marching band, competing on the New Rochelle campus as the Mustangs (NJCAA Division I). The Monroe Express, based out of the Bronx campus, has seven teams competing at the NJCAA Division III level.
